No, the ecowittModules block will work only in conjunction with the ecowitt plugin ( as it defines differently a few fields that are checked by the ecovittModules block, particularly the batteries fields should be numeric ).
If you want to use this way ( I mean: weather station->FOSHKplugin->meteotemplate ) you have to configure FOSHKplugin to forward data to the ecowitt plugin in ecowitt format

I have updated both block and plugin ( you may find them in the meteotemplate forum, in the respective subforums ) to include all ecowitt sensors and 'a few' other things ( such as virtual sensors and sensor rename ).
But the two versions are now incompatible: so if you want to install the iz0qwm ecowitt plugin you have to use his ecowittModules block ( and if you want to use my ecowitt plugin you have to use my ecowittModules block )
